## Configuration

Wayfork handles mobile deep-link routing for the Lanterbay apps. All routing config lives in the service env file; no dashboard overrides. Set WAYFORK_ROUTE_MAP to the published map version, WAYFORK_FALLBACK_URL for unresolvable links, and WAYFORK_ENV to match the release channel. Staging and prod must not share map versions — link previews will break. Release manager owns the prod file; changes ship with the cut, never hotfixed. One more required line follows the fallback entry: it sets the link-signing secret.

env line for fafof-fahag: LEDGER_TOKEN5=f8790

### Step 4: Fix the reconnect loop

Quick one for the sync: Pebblecast's websocket client was hammering the gateway after any dropped connection because the backoff timer reset on every attempt. The new client in v3 honors jittered exponential backoff, but only if you migrate these settings before upgrading. Skipping this means the old loop comes back. Set the following values in the service config before rolling out.

service settings:
novath:
  pin: 1396
  tenant: pelys
  seal: seal_ccc035e1
  metrics_host: metrics.novath.qorvelworks.test
  standby_team: fraeth
  escalation: drueth-zorok
  nonce: 61d508

Ticket: Blue-green deploys for the billing worker (Coinmarsh) blocked. The deploy orchestrator's credential expired Friday, so green environments can't register with the router and cutover fails at the health-check step. New folks: this is the third expiry this year; rotation is manual, see the runbook. To unblock, rotate the orchestrator credential, redeploy green, verify traffic shift. The rotated credential for the orchestrator is below.

gateway credential: kto23_LX9A4ys6i4nzHtpOLNLodKK